Claims
- 1. An arrangement for automatically, selectably diverting, different-weight checks being transported along a prescribed track with divert-blade means at a prescribed divert-station therealong, said checks comprising "standard" and "non-standard", heavier versions, this arrangement comprising, in combination with the foregoing:
- weight sense means, disposed along said track, upstream of said divert station, for sensing at least a mass characteristic of passing checks and outputting mass-indicating signals SS representative thereof; actuate means arranged to thrust said blade means across said track and associated actuate-adjust means for adjusting actuation-torque of said actuate means responsive to associated torque-adjust signals AA input thereto; and control means arranged to receive said mass-indicating signals SS, manipulating them and applying associated torque-adjust signals AA to said actuate-adjust means whereby to automatically adjust and control the torque applied to said blade means according to the sensed weight condition of a said check; said control means and actuate-adjust means being set to normally handle said "standard" weight checks, and adapted to increase actuation-torque upon detection of a "heavier" check.
- 2. The invention of claim 1, where said characteristics comprise check-weight, -length, -height, and -thickness.
- 3. The invention of claim 1, wherein said control means comprises electronic microcomputer means.
- 4. The invention of claim 1, wherein said actuate means comprises motor means.
- 5. The invention of claim 4, where said actuate-adjust means comprises selectible torque-transmit means.
- 6. The invention of claim 1, wherein said arrangement is thus enabled to so thrust said blade means more quickly and forcefully when heavier checks are sensed.
- 7. The invention of claim 6, where said actuate means comprises motor means.
- 8. The invention of claim 7, where said actuate-adjust means comprises selectible torque-transmit means.
- 9. The invention of claim 8, where said control means comprises electronic microcomputer means.
- 10. The invention of claim 9, where said characteristics comprise check-weight, -length, -height, and -thickness.
Parent Case Info
This case is a Continuation of Provisional Application SN 60/004,711, for SMART SELECT UNIT FOR DOCUMENT DIVERSION, filed Oct. 3, 1995 and claims priority therefrom.
This relates to arrangements for sorting checks, and especially where the "sort-modes", and related "gates ", are made conditional and selectable according to document condition.
